Yahtzee is a dice game with roots from dice games popular in a variety of cultures. The objective of the game is to collect the most points by rolling certain combinations of the five dice. Edwin S. Lowe, a game entrepreneur, was the first to trademark the game, doing so in 1956. In 1973, Milton Bradley purchased Lowe’s company, along with the rights to produce Yahtzee. Having acquired Milton Bradley in 1984, Hasbro currently produces the Yahtzee game.
